Sérgio Tosi Rodrigues is a scholar working on Physical Therapy, Sports Therapy and Rehabilitation, Orthopedics and Sports Medicine and Cognitive Neuroscience. According to data from OpenAlex, Sérgio Tosi Rodrigues has authored 35 papers receiving a total of 560 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 19 papers in Physical Therapy, Sports Therapy and Rehabilitation, 16 papers in Orthopedics and Sports Medicine and 14 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ience. Recurrent topics in Sérgio Tosi Rodrigues’s work include Balance, Gait, and Falls Prevention (17 papers), Motor Control and Adaptation (7 papers) and Effects of Vibration on Health (7 papers). Sérgio Tosi Rodrigues is often cited by papers focused on Balance, Gait, and Falls Prevention (17 papers), Motor Control and Adaptation (7 papers) and Effects of Vibration on Health (7 papers). Sérgio Tosi Rodrigues collaborates with scholars based in Brazil, United Kingdom and The Netherlands. Sérgio Tosi Rodrigues's co-authors include Joan N. Vickers, Alan F. Williams, A. Mark Williams, Paula Fávaro Polastri, Fábio Augusto Barbieri, José Ângelo Barela, Renato Moraes, Alessandro Moura Zagatto, Lucas Simieli and Ricardo Augusto Barbieri and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Experimental Brain Research and Behavioural Brain Research.
